How doctors and hospitals shape the policy outcome

Network breadth matters. If a plan connects to a wide hospital web across metros and tier-two towns, the day-to-day value climbs. Cashless approval speed often reflects the insurer’s backend readiness, not just the fine print. It pays to verify whether OPD services, diagnostic tests, and parental dependents are included or offered via add-ons. Consumers should also check how much of the room category is covered and what stays out of pocket. These details push a policy from decent to dependable when time is tight and health concerns are pressing.

Claims reality and how to dodge common snags

People fear claims more than premiums because delays bite. A clear path through the claim maze includes minimum documentation, known timelines, and a point of contact who speaks plainly. Some plans require pre-authorization for certain treatments; others let cashless claims ride on a single portal step. The best schemes publish sample claim forms and common-sense steps, so a user knows what to expect. Reading user feedback, even casual threads, often reveals gaps a glossy advert misses—like surprise co-pays or age-related exclusions—so those are checked before signing.
